One interesting thing about idioms is that they are generally instances of figurative language that have been used so many times that they become a part of the language understood by native speakers without having to decode it. Cross your fingers For good luck Fell on deaf ears People wouldnt listen to something Get cold feet Be nervous Giving the cold shoulder Ignore someone Have a change of heart Changed your mind Im all ears You have my full attention It cost an arm and a leg It was expensive Play it by ear Improvise See eye to eye Agree. Humpty Dumpty sat on a wall By Mother Goose personification Mary Had a Little Lamb by Sarah Josepha Hale simile I Wandered Lonely as a Cloud by William Wordsworth simile and hyperbole A Red Red Rose by Robert Burns metaphor.
